Detoxification Basics

In the last episode, we discussed the fact that toxins come from food, air, water, personal care products, and pretty much everything we encounter. Detoxification is an ongoing process that is always at work in your body. Here are the basics about how detoxification happens, what resources your body needs, and why it sometimes feels yucky. Detoxification happens in three phases. Phase one involves chemical reactions, mostly in the cytochrome P450 system. Toxins: The Energy Killer

Toxins are everywhere in modern life, and they have always been a normal part of life because they come from food, bacteria, mold, yeast, air, water, and the soil. Also, now, industrial and agricultural chemicals, the products we use on our skin, teeth, hair, and nails, and things we use to care for our homes like air fresheners, cleaning products, and that sort of thing. Toxins are everywhere and they can accumulate in your system causing symptoms like fatigue, exhaustion, brain fog, weakness, poor memory, difficulty concentrating, skin outbreaks, constipation, and irritability. You Don't Have Energy If You Don't Breathe

Problems with oxygenation can affect your sleep quality and quantity, leaving you feeling tired, or like you slept but woke up as tired as you were the night before, or just plain exhausted. Iron deficiency and carbon monoxide poisoning are both oxygen problems, not that we think of them that way, but many oxygen problems are more subtle. The classic oxygen problem overnight is sleep apnea, which causes you to wake up through the night becuase you stop breathing momentarily. Mouth breathing at night also impairs oxygen and leads to fatigue, low energy, and a poor night's sleep. Subclinical hypothyroid and Fertility

Overtly low or overtly high thyroid levels are a well known risk factor for infertility, but today we're going to talk about something a little bit less well known, which is subclinical hypothyroid and fertility. Subclinical hypothyroid is when the thyroid tests are on the lower end of normal, but still within normal limits. The patient experiencing this might have symptoms of mild low thyroid, or might be asymptomatic, but research is showing a link between this "normal" thyroid and fertility difficulty.
